Poor Decision Leaves Group Battling to Escape the Mountain
Our scenic adventure quickly turned to a frozen nightmare as we struggled to take the easy way out on a remote trail in Moab Utah. We spent the night at Elephant Hill Park and in the morning we decided to take the long and scenic Overland route in order to avoid any potential issues with @WillometMotorFab Jeep Wagoneer. Unfortunately this plan backfired as we gained elevation and encountered heavy snow. The crew aired down as low as our tires would allow us and tried to push through. @DirtLifestyle and @KrokemOutdoors took turns trail blazing in their jeeps as the @MarlinCrawlerMedia Toyota Tacoma and Toyota four Runner as well as @TaylorGibleroffroad Jeep Gladiator pulled the rickety Wagoneer through some of the worst snow conditions I have ever encountered. After 20 hours we were practically out of fuel as daylight faded away. We emptied the last drops of fuel from our rotopax into our trucks and the mad rush to rescue members of our group before freezing temps set in began as we battled exhaustion and the elements to escape the mountain and find fuel for the Wagoneer. #offroad #overlanding #jeepgladiator
